Study Architecture in Poland

You can study architecture in Poland in English at both the undergraduate and graduate levels. Universities like the Warsaw University of Technology, the Cracow University of Technology, and the Gdask University of Technology offer architecture courses at affordable tuition to international students. A bachelor’s degree in architecture in Poland lasts 8 semesters and concludes with a Bachelor of Science or Bachelor of Arts degree in architecture. Whereas a master’s degree in architecture that lasts 1.5 to 2 years culminates in a Master of Sciences degree in the area of architecture.

The Polish universities mentioned in the article follow the newest architectural education standards and are accredited by the concerned agencies to offer these programs, thus ensuring quality education. Highlights: Study Architecture in Poland

Courses offered  BSc/BA in Architecture (undergraduate) and MSc/MA in Architecture (postgraduate)
Duration of BSc in Architecture  3.5-4 years 
Duration of MSc in Architecture   2 years 
Annual tuition fees for BSc in Architecture  2,625-7,680 EUR
Annual tuition fees for MSc in Architecture  4,000-8,300 EUR

Best Universities to Study Architecture in Poland

University Name QS World University Rankings by Subject 2023: Architecture & Built Environment 
Warsaw University of Technology 151-200
Cracow University of Technology 201-240
Gdańsk University of Technology 201-240

Warsaw University of Technology

Ranking at positions 151-200 by QS for architectural programs, the Warsaw University of Technology is the largest Polish university in technical sciences. Although it was established in 1915, its roots can be traced back to 1826, making it the oldest technical institute in the country.

The faculty of Architecture at Warsaw University of Technology delivers two programs in architecture. The undergraduate program is BSc Architecture, and the graduate program is MSc Architecture with a specialization in Architecture for the Society of Knowledge and urban planning.

Program Name  Duration  Annual Tuition Fees (EUR)
BSc Architecture  4 years  7,680
MSc Architecture ASK [Architecture for Society of Knowledge] 2 years 8,300

Cracow University of Technology 

The Cracow University of Technology also called the Politechnika Krakowska has a 70-year-old history. It was founded in 1945 and ranks as one of the best technical institutes in the country. With 8 faculties university and 11 majors are taught in English. Currently, the institute holds 190,000 students that are pursuing a degree or other related programs at the university. 

The university’s Faculty of Architecture offers both undergraduate and graduate programs in architecture. The programs offered are accredited by the European Network for Accreditation of Engineering Education, the Royal Institute of British Architects (RIBA), the Polish Accreditation Committee, and the Accreditation Commission for Polish Universities of Technology. These accreditations give the university an advantage over other universities offering similar programs.

Program Name  Duration  Annual Tuition Fees (EUR)
BA Architecture  4 years  5,000 
Master in Architecture (M.Arch.) 1.5 years  5,000

Gdańsk University of Technology

Drawing on rich academic traditions, this technical university ranks 201-240 in the QS World University Rankings of Architecture & Built Environment. Nearly 15,000 students are enrolled in study programs at eight of its faculties. The Gdańsk University of Technology offers the following study courses in architecture. 

Program Name  Duration  Annual Tuition Fees (EUR)
Bachelor of Science in Architecture 4 years  3,870
Master of Science in Architecture 2 years  3,870

Poznan University of Technology

The Poznan University of Technology is a public technical university in Poland established in 1919. There are nine faculty at this institution of higher education that offers courses at the undergraduate and postgraduate level. The following programs are offered by the Faculty of Architecture at the Poznan University of Technology. 

Program Name  Duration  Annual Tuition Fees (EUR)
B.Sc. in Architecture 4 years  3,833
M.Sc. in Architecture  2 years 4,058

Vistula University

Established in 1992, Vistula University is a private higher education institute in Poland. It offers 52 bachelor’s and master’s programs to the 12 thousand students currently enrolled at the university. The Academy of Finance and Business Vistula at Vistula University offers an undergraduate degree in architecture. The degree awards the title of engineer architect.

Program Name  Duration  Annual Tuition Fees (EUR)
Architecture 4 years 3,000

University College of Enterprise and Administration in Lublin

The University College of Enterprise and Administration in Lublin (WSPA) is a private university in Poland established in 1998. It has two faculties: The Faculty of Technical Sciences and the Faculty of Social Sciences. The Faculty of Technical Sciences offers the following undergraduate program in architecture in English. 

Program Name  Duration  Annual Tuition Fees (EUR)
Architecture 4 years 2,625

Admission Requirements to Study Architecture in Poland

The admission criteria are almost the same for bachelor’s and master’s level programs in architecture in Poland except for the academic requirements. 

Bachelor’s Level

  • High school diploma
  • English language proficiency at B2 level (IELTS 5.5 or TOEFL 70)
  • Passport 
  • Student visa 
  • Motivational letter 
  • Reference letters
  • University entrance test (if any)
  • Portfolio

Master’s Level

  • Bachelor’s degree in architecture or related fields 
  • English language proficiency (IELTS 6.0 or TOEFL 80)
  • Passport 
  • Student visa 
  • Motivational letter 
  • Reference letters
  • University entrance test (if any)
  • Portfolio

Career Opportunities

After completing their first-cycle degree in architecture, graduates are ready to begin their professional careers in implementation, construction, and supervision in civil engineering, urban planning, and developing architectural structures. Completing the coursework enables graduates to continue their education in the second cycle. A master’s degree in architecture imparts them with advanced technical skills and knowledge to start working as architects and increases both their employment prospects and salary expectations. Students interested in research and academics can also pursue a doctorate in the field. The average salary for architects in Poland is 34,380 EUR (ERI Economic Research Institute).

Note: The field of architecture is regulated in Poland and thus graduates must register their degree with the National Chamber of Polish Architects (IARP) to be able to start working as architects.
